Real-time prediction models for output power and efficiency of grid-connected solar photovoltaic systems

Reads0
Chats0
TLDR
In this paper, the authors developed new real-time prediction models for output power and energy efficiency of solar photovoltaic (PV) systems using measured data of a grid-connected solar PV system in Macau.
About
This article is published in Applied Energy.The article was published on 2012-05-01. It has received 95 citations till now. The article focuses on the topics: Photovoltaic system & Solar irradiance.
